Transaction 100ec4a821eff80c9324a57e30b62f45545eb3fbd3cdaab5acddacd9826e77ef
1 Input
2 Outputs
- 100ec4a821eff80c9324a57e30b62f45545eb3fbd3cdaab5acddacd9826e77ef:0
- 100ec4a821eff80c9324a57e30b62f45545eb3fbd3cdaab5acddacd9826e77ef:1
value 48761697
address 3FABgTsrTYe1poFTXGizcf7N784jH5E88t
value 491975577
address 13tS8UwSTZ6VmZxNeZb4zdTsNa4B82bcdk